What Should You Pay Attention to When Learning to Drive for the First Time?

1 Answers
Tommy
07/28/25 3:12pm
When learning to drive for the first time, you should pay attention to checking the vehicle condition, adjusting the seat, fastening the seat belt, and effectively communicating with the instructor. Additionally, maintaining a good mindset is essential. Below are some key points to note for first-time drivers: 1. Fasten the seat belt: Besides yourself, remind all passengers to buckle up if their seats have seat belts. 2. Adjust the seat position: For manual transmission cars, adjust the left foot position—the ball of your foot should fully depress the clutch with some room to spare. For automatic transmission cars, adjust the throttle position. Once the foot position is set, the hand position usually won’t be a major issue; adjust your hands for comfortable steering wheel operation. The backrest should be set for comfort, but avoid reclining too far, as lying back can reduce the effectiveness of the seat belt. 3. Familiarize yourself with the car: If it’s an unfamiliar vehicle, first get to know the gear positions, lights, horn, and other controls, as settings vary by manufacturer. Familiarize yourself with the gear positions before starting the engine; other controls can be learned afterward.

What is the Scoring Criteria for Parallel Parking?

Here is a detailed introduction to the scoring criteria for parallel parking: 1. Vehicle out of bounds: If the vehicle crosses the line after stopping in the parking space, it is considered a failure. 2. Incorrect use of turn signals: Failing to use or incorrectly using turn signals when exiting the parking space results in a 10-point deduction. 3. Time limit exceeded: If the task completion time exceeds 90 seconds, it is considered a failure. 4. Vehicle body touching the line: If the vehicle body touches the boundary line of the parking space while moving, a 10-point deduction per occurrence applies. 5. Wheels crossing the line: If the wheels touch or cross the lane boundary line while moving, a 10-point deduction per occurrence applies. 6. Midway stop: Stopping for more than 2 seconds during the process results in a 5-point deduction per occurrence.

What does BYD mean?

BYD is the abbreviation for BYD Auto. The full English name of BYD is 'Build Your Dreams', which translates to 'Achieving Dreams'. BYD is a Chinese automotive brand founded in 1995, primarily manufacturing commercial vehicles, family cars, and batteries. Relevant information about BYD is as follows: 1. Introduction: BYD is a Chinese automotive brand established in 1995, mainly producing commercial vehicles, family cars, and batteries. Starting with a team of just over 20 people, it grew to become the world's second-largest rechargeable battery manufacturer by 2003, and in the same year, it established BYD Auto. 2. Logo Meaning: The new BYD logo no longer uses the original blue and white color scheme. The design has been changed to an oval shape with the addition of light and shadow elements. There have been significant changes in the font arrangement and graphic colors, highlighting BYD Auto's innovation, technology, and the essence of corporate culture, infusing the BYD brand with new meaning and vitality.

How many points are deducted for the car body crossing the line in parallel parking?

In parallel parking, if the car body crosses the line, 100 points will be deducted, resulting in failure. Below are the specific details about parallel parking: 1. Requirement: The test evaluates the driver's ability to correctly park the vehicle into a roadside parking space on the right. The driver must park the vehicle into the right-side parking space without the wheels touching the lane boundary line or the parking space boundary line. 2. Precautions: Adjust the right rearview mirror, and try to lower the left rearview mirror as much as possible to see the left rear wheel. The right rearview mirror should allow visibility of the car body. Adjust the interior rearview mirror so that when you look up, you can see the middle of the rear windshield.

Is a New Energy Vehicle Scrapped if Submerged in Water?

The power battery is the core of a new energy vehicle. The battery is extensively laid out at the chassis of the vehicle, making it more likely to come into contact with water during floods or rainy seasons. Currently, automakers predominantly use ternary lithium batteries, which offer long lifespan and high energy density but vary in stability. According to national regulations, the waterproof level of batteries must reach IP67, meaning the battery can be submerged in water at a certain depth under normal temperature without leakage or electric shock. Additional relevant information is as follows: Note 1: Domestic new energy vehicle manufacturers claim their power battery protection level reaches "IP67" (meaning the battery can be submerged in water at a certain depth for 30 minutes without damage). The highest protection level currently is IP68. Note 2: If a new energy vehicle is submerged in water, especially the power battery, it can cause significant financial losses to the owner. Where to Initially Position for Parallel Parking?

Parallel parking initially positions at the rear two-thirds of the adjacent vehicle. Here are specific details about the new parallel parking regulations: 1. Ground Markings: Previously, parallel parking used four upright poles to mark the corners of the parking space. One criterion for successful parking was whether the vehicle entered the space without touching these poles. After the new traffic rules were implemented, parallel parking no longer uses poles; instead, ground markings define the parking space boundaries. 2. Allowed to Pause Mid-Process: Previously, pausing during parallel parking or reversing into a parking space resulted in immediate failure. Under the new rules, pausing only deducts five points. 3. Timed Assessment: Parallel parking must be completed within 90 seconds.
